Complete failure in Moscow: Putin turns down U.S. proposals on Ukraine (video)

The nearly five-hour meeting between Vladimir Putin and American envoy Steve Witkoff, attended by Jared Kushner, failed to produce progress on the occupied territories in Ukraine.

The Kremlin admitted, through advisor Yuri Ushakov, that „no compromise solution has been chosen yet,” even though „certain American proposals can be discussed,” reports AFP.

According to Ushakov, the discussions were "constructive": "We managed to agree on some points (...), others were criticized, but the essential thing is that a constructive discussion took place and the parties declared their willingness to continue their efforts." However, he warns that "there is still much work to be done" to reach an agreement, especially as Russian troops are accelerating their advance.

A Ukrainian source cited by AFP states that Witkoff and Kushner could have a meeting with a delegation from Kiev in a European country on Wednesday, continuing the negotiations that began in Washington and were adjusted in consultation with Ukrainian authorities.

Prior to the talks with the Americans, Vladimir Putin accused Europe of trying to "obstruct" Washington's plan and issued new threats: "We do not want war with Europe, but if Europe wants it and starts it, then we are ready right now."

The statements of the Russian leader contrast with the optimism of NATO Secretary-General Mark Rutte, who said that US diplomatic efforts will "eventually restore peace in Europe." Washington has, in fact, declared itself "very optimistic" about the peace plan presented two weeks ago.

American President Donald Trump acknowledged the difficulty of the negotiations: "It's not an easy situation, believe me. What a mess it is!" stated the leader from Washington.

At the same time,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ky accused Moscow of using the discussions "to try to weaken the sanctions." While in Ireland, Zelensky emphasized that Ukraine demands an end to the war, not "just a break" between battles.
